The ASCRS Online Post-Refractive Intraocular Lens Power Calculator
A particularly useful resource for calculating IOL power in a post–refractive surgery patient has been developed by Warren Hill, MD; Li Wang, MD, PhD; and Douglas D. Koch, MD. It is available on the website of the American Society of Cataract and Refractive Surgery (ASCRS) (www.ascrs.org) and directly at http://iolcalc.ascrs.org.
To use this IOL calculator, the surgeon selects the appropriate prior refractive surgical procedure and enters the patient data, if known (Fig 11-1). The IOL powers, calculated by a variety of formulas, are displayed at the bottom of the form, and the surgeon can compare the results to select the best IOL power for the individual situation. This spreadsheet is updated with new formulas and information as they become available and, at this time, probably represents the best option for calculation of IOL powers in post–refractive surgery patients.
